National (Senior) Director, Field Medical Affairs

Orca Bio is a late-stage biotechnology company focused on redefining the transplant process through next-generation cell therapies. The National (Senior) Director of Field Medical Affairs will lead the Medical Science Liaison team, optimizing performance and ensuring scientific engagement across institutions to support the company's mission of improving survival rates for blood cancer patients.

Responsibilities

Lead, mentor, and develop an established national MSL team, ensuring ongoing scientific excellence, performance management, and professional growth
Evolve and optimize MSL operational frameworks, SOPs, training programs, and CRM utilization to support launch and post-launch needs
Translate Medical Affairs strategy into clear field execution plans with defined objectives, metrics, and accountability
Advise Medical Affairs leadership on MSL coverage models, territory design, and future headcount expansion aligned with indication growth and organizational scale
Oversee strategic KOL identification, engagement planning, and scientific exchange to support launch readiness, data dissemination, and insight generation
Direct compliant collection, synthesis, and internal communication of actionable field insights to inform Medical, Clinical Development, Commercial, and Access strategies
Provide strategic oversight of field medical support for clinical trials, including investigator engagement and site education
Partner cross-functionally on congress strategy, advisory boards, medical education initiatives, and special enterprise priorities
Ensure the highest standards of compliance with FDA, OIG, PhRMA, and Orca Bio policies governing scientific exchange
Represent Orca Bio at scientific congresses, advisory boards, and external medical forums
Maintain deep scientific and clinical expertise in hematologic malignancies and cell therapy through continuous learning

Required

Doctorate-level advanced scientific or clinical degree (MD, PharmD, PhD, or MSN required)
8+ years of Medical Affairs experience, including prior MSL experience and ≥3 years leading field-based medical teams
Demonstrated success leading field medical organizations through launch or late-stage development
Strong command of US medical affairs compliance requirements and field governance
Proven ability to lead, coach, and scale high-performing MSL teams
Exceptional strategic thinking, communication, and cross-functional leadership skills

Preferred

Cell and/or gene therapy experience
Experience working in small biotech company or start-up environments
Direct experience supporting first-launch or near-launch assets
